接口:根据活动id获取活动详情

  • 根据活动id获取活动详情

请求URL:

GET/v2/activity-detail/index

参数:

参数名 是否必须 类型 说明
id int 活动ID
app_id string appId
signed_at string 时间戳
sign string 签名

返回示例:

正确时返回:

{
    "code": 200,
    "msg": "",
    "data": {
        "activity": {
            "id": 43137854,
            "title": "测试订单县骨干",
            "user_id": 21200013,
            "business_account_id": 26600001,
            "sponsor": "微吼直播",
            "start_time": "2021-05-21 00:00:00",
            "real_start_time": "2021-05-20 16:41:27",
            "end_time": "2021-05-20 16:45:37",
            "img_url": "",
            "description": "测试订单想逛",
            "status": "FINISH",
            "view_condition": "NONE",
            "live_room": "lss_657928eb",
            "hd_room": "inav_aa5dabb5",
            "channel_room": "ch_jC0vU5Km",
            "ext_channel_room": "ch_gAAvyG0l",
            "published": "Y",
            "created_at": "2021-05-20 16:40:51",
            "admin_closed": "N",
            "entry_time": 30,
            "is_portrait": "N",
            "is_playback": "N",
            "layout": 1,
            "manual": 2,
            "auth_chat": 2,
            "chat_filter": 2,
            "tags": [
                {
                    "id": 1,
                    "name": "互联网"
                }
            ],
            "valid_status": "N",
            "user_count": 3,
            "appointment_count": 0,
            "sign_count": 0,
            "visit_num": "5",
            "data_finish_time": "2021-05-20 17:00:37",
            "whitelist_status": "N",
            "gift_status": "N",
            "reward_status": "N",
            "global_gift_status": "N",
            "global_reward_status": "N"
        },
        "prepare": [
            {
                "submodule": "BASE",
                "switch": true,
                "desc": null,
                "is_set": null
            },
            {
                "submodule": "APPOINT",
                "switch": false,
                "desc": null,
                "is_set": false
            },
            {
                "submodule": "WARMUP",
                "switch": false,
                "desc": "",
                "is_set": false
            }
        ],
        "brand": [
            {
                "submodule": "TEMPLATE",
                "switch": false,
                "desc": "Y",
                "is_set": false
            },
            {
                "submodule": "LIVE_WATCH",
                "switch": true,
                "desc": "Y",
                "is_set": true
            },
            {
                "submodule": "INVITE_CARD",
                "switch": true,
                "desc": null,
                "is_set": null
            },
            {
                "submodule": "POSTER",
                "switch": true,
                "desc": null,
                "is_set": null
            },
            {
                "submodule": "PAGE_SCRIPT",
                "switch": true,
                "desc": null,
                "is_set": null
            },
            {
                "submodule": "INVITE_CARD",
                "switch": true,
                "desc": null,
                "is_set": null
            }
        ],
        "promote": [
            {
                "submodule": "EXPAND_NOTICE",
                "switch": false,
                "desc": "PLAYBACK",
                "is_set": true
            },
            {
                "submodule": "EXPAND_EMAIL",
                "switch": true,
                "desc": null,
                "is_set": false
            },
            {
                "submodule": "EXPAND_SMS",
                "switch": true,
                "desc": null,
                "is_set": false
            }
        ],
        "record": [
            {
                "submodule": "PLAYBACK",
                "switch": true,
                "desc": null,
                "is_set": false
            }
        ],
        "data": {
            "time": "2021-05-20 17:00:37"
        }
    },
    "request_id": "ff107a75-a3b9-4763-bcd3-db6f4a1c"
}

错误时返回:

{
    "code": 201,
    "msg": "invalid appid",
    "data": {}
}

返回参数说明:

公共相应参数,详细内容请参考[返回结果]

返回数据如下:

参数名 类型 说明
activity.id int 课程ID
activity.title string 活动标题
activity.user_id int 客户id
activity.business_account_id int 客户账号id
activity.sponsor string 主办方
activity.start_time string 预计开始时间
activity.real_start_time string 真正开始时间
activity.end_time string 直播结束时间
activity.img_url string 活动图片地址
activity.description string 活动描述
activity.status string 活动状态
activity.view_condition string 观看条件NONE: 无限制 INVITATION: 邀请APPOINT: 预约报名
activity.live_room string 直播房间id
activity.hd_room string 互动房间id
activity.channel_room string 聊天频道房间id
activity.ext_channel_room string 扩展消息频道
activity.published string 是否发布:Y=>是,N=>否
activity.created_at string 创建时间
activity.admin_closed string 是否被后台关闭:Y=>是,N=>否
activity.entry_time string 预期提前时间:30分钟,默认
activity.whitelist_status string 白名单状态
activity.is_portrait string
activity.is_playback string
activity.layout int 1.视频直播 2. 文档直播
activity.manual int 活动报名人工审核开启状态 1.开启 2.关闭
activity.auth_chat int 聊天人工审核开关1开启 2关闭
activity.chat_filter int 聊天严禁词过滤状态1开启 2关闭
activity.gift_status int 礼物开关 1:开启 2:关闭
activity.reward_status int 打赏开关 1:开启 2:关闭
activity.global_gift_status int 通用礼物开关 1:开启 2:关闭
activity.global_reward_status int 通用打赏开关 1:开启 2:关闭
activity.data_finish_time string 数据计算完成时间
activity.valid_status string N
activity.user_count int 用户总数
activity.appointment_count int 预约总数
activity.sign_count int 报名总数
activity.visit_num int 访问总数
activity.tags array 活动标签

备注:

  • 更多返回错误代码请看首页的错误代码描述